Party General Secretary To Lam unanimously elected State President of Viet Nam
Party General Secretary To Lam was elected by the 16th National Assembly as State President for the 2026-2031 term.
Party General Secretary and State President To Lam makes a public pledge of allegiance to the Constitution at the Headquarters of the National Assembly, Ha Noi, April 7, 2026. Photo: VGP
Continuing the personnel work at the first session of the 16th National Assembly, on the morning of April 7th, the National Assembly proceeded with the procedures to elect the State President of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am.
With 495 out of 495 delegates voting in favor, the National Assembly passed a resolution electing Comrade To Lam, General Secretary of the Central Committee of the Communist Party of Vietnam and a member of the 16th National Assembly, to the position of President of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am for the term 2026-2031.
"Under the sacred red flag with a yellow star of the Fatherland, before the National Assembly, the people and voters, I, President of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am, solemnly swear: To be absolutely loyal to the Fatherland, to the people, to the Constitution of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am, and to strive to fulfill all the tasks entrusted by the Party, the State and the people," State President To Lam declared in his oath of office.

Party General Secretary and State President To Lam was born on July 10, 1957, in Nghĩa Trụ commune, Hưng Yên province. He holds the titles of Professor and Doctor of Laws.
He was a member of the Central Committee of the Party for the 11th, 12th, 13th, and 14th terms; a member of the Politburo for the 12th, 13th, and 14th terms; and a delegate to the National Assembly for the 14th, 15th, and 16th terms.
Also on the morning of April 7th, the National Assembly heard a report from the Standing Committee of the National Assembly on the results of approving the personnel for the positions of Vice Chairman of the Council of Ethnic Minorities, Vice Chairmen of Committees, and members who are full-time National Assembly deputies working in the Council and Committees.
This afternoon, the National Assembly will proceed with the procedures to elect the Prime Minister, the State Vice President, the Chief Justice of the Supreme People's Court, and the Prosecutor General of the Supreme People's Procuracy. After being elected, the Prime Minister and the Chief Justice of the Supreme People's Court will take the oath of office as prescribed.
